JOB DESCRIPTION
JOB TITLE: Cook/Gardener
SALARY BAND: SG3
RESPONSIBLE TO: Island Manager
HOURS OF WORK: 40 hours per week and upon request overtime
Job Responsibilities:
- To be responsible for all food preparation, serving, clean-up, kitchen hygiene and all equipment, ensuring that all food wastes are being properly disposed of according to the Aldabra disposal waste policy.
- To provide full catering services including the baking of bread and other pastry for residents and visitors as per the Island Manager’s request.
- To liaise with the Island Manager with regards to food stock and monthly costing for staff meals and also do stocktaking and record-keeping of all kitchen utensils and equipment.
- Maintain the garden for island consumption.
- Assist with maintenance and upkeep of research station, settlement, field camps, trails and equipment, in the absence of visitors.
- Compile with all SIF policies relating to wildlife, plants and the environment.
- Ensure that biosecurity measures are implemented to the highest standards for the transit of supplies, equipment, and staff. This may require performing biosecurity checks/briefings at a designated location.
- Liaise with the Island Manager, operations staff and designated biosecurity officers to ensure internal biosecurity processes operate smoothly.
- Participate in anti-poaching patrol and surveillance under the guidance of the Island Manager or other designated person.
- Accompany and guide visitors on Aldabra and ensure that their conduct is environmentally sound and that they abide by SIF policies.
- Enforce waste policies and conduct periodic clean-ups with field staff especially within those areas used by tourists and other visitors.
- Carry out any work-related duties as may be assigned by Supervisor.
MINIMUM ENTRY REQUIREMENTS;
Graduate in Food and Beverages or 5 years working experience as a senior cook.
